したがって、基本的にはクラスの週間スケジュールを表示する必要があります。これを非常にコンパクトにしたいので、クラスが毎日午前/午後/夕方に実行されるかどうかだけを示したいと思います(実際の時間範囲はいつか決定します)。
つまり、グリッドに配置された場合、21個のセルがあります(添付の画像を参照)。マウスオーバー/クリックの実際の時間をツールチップに含めます(例:14:00-16:00)。
21セルのグリッドよりも、この情報を表示するためのより効率的でコンパクトな方法があるに違いありませんか?アイデアや経験があれば教えてください。ありがとう。
EDIT:少しコンテキストについては、これらのコースを検索結果として表示しているため、これをコンパクトにする必要があります。スケジュール設定の「概要」として。
いくつかの仮定を行いましたが、これは、表示する必要がある最も関連性の高い情報を考えると、私が考えることができる最もコンパクトなバージョンです。
過去に似たようなことに取り組んだことを覚えています。オプションの1つは、粒子表示を使用することです。 Googleカレンダーアプリと同じように、複数のビューを使用して、「ズームイン」する(ビューを切り替える)と、より詳細に表示できます。これは、レイアウトをやり直すことも意味します。細かい粒度で時間の詳細を明らかにすることもできます。